Tackling Coding Challenges: A Step-by-Step Guide
Venturing into the world of coding challenges can be both exhilarating and daunting. However, with the effective approach, you can transform these hurdles into stepping stones for your growth as a developer. To navigate this journey successfully, consider following these key steps: initially
- Thoroughly read and understand the problem statement. Identify the core requirements and any specific constraints.
- Conceptualize potential solutions. Don't be afraid to explore different strategies. Sketch out your ideas on paper or use a whiteboard for visualization
- Code your solution in a logical manner. Utilize best practices and document your code for readability.
- Test your code thoroughly. Fix any errors or inconsistencies. Use a variety of test cases to ensure your solution is robust.
- Seek feedback from other developers or mentors. A fresh perspective can often point out areas for improvement.
Remember that coding challenges are not just about finding the ideal solution, check here but also about the development process. Embrace every opportunity to expand your skills and understanding.
